Wie blockiere ich Hot Network Questions in der Seitenleiste des Stack Exchange-Netzwerks?


81

Betriebssystem ist Ubuntu 14. Firefox ist 50.1.0

Das habe ich versucht:

Bildbeschreibung hier eingeben

Danach habe ich Firefox neu gestartet. Es gab keine Wirkung.

Wie können Sie diese heißen Fragen in der Seitenleiste blockieren?


2
Der Filter sieht in Ordnung aus. Es wird auch sofort wirksam, da Firefox nicht neu gestartet werden muss. Sind Sie sicher, dass ABP für Stack Overflow aktiviert ist ?
Daniel B

11
Sowohl das Blockieren der Seitenleiste als auch das Filtern einzelner Websites wurden bereits zuvor auf Meta diskutiert und gelöst .
Lilienthal

4
Warum aus Neugier diese bestimmte Seitenleiste sperren?
Bug-A-Lot

5
@ bug-a-lot: es ist für viele Menschen eine Zeitsenke schlechter als TV Tropes.
RemcoGerlich

Antworten:


76

Dies ist eine von 50 oder 60 Verbesserungen der SE-Benutzeroberfläche im Stack Apps-Add-On- SOX . Sie können es von diesem Link laden. Außerdem muss ein Userscript-Manager installiert sein - Greasemonkey (für Firefox), Tampermonkey (für Chrome) oder NinjaKit (für Safari).

Um Hot-Network-Fragen zu blockieren, wählen Sie die Option "Hot-Network-Fragen ausblenden" im Abschnitt "Darstellung" des Funktionsmenüs. Das Funktionsmenü kann über eine Schaltfläche in der oberen Leiste aufgerufen werden:

newdialog

Übrigens können Sie mit einer weiteren Funktion filtern, was in der HNQ-Liste nach Standort und anderen Attributen angezeigt wird. Die vollständige Liste der Funktionen finden Sie hier . Viele der Verbesserungen sind unverzichtbar.

Ich würde empfehlen, die Entwicklungsversion anstatt der offiziellen Version zu installieren. Die Entwicklungsversion enthält neue Verbesserungen, aber wichtiger ist, dass sie die neuesten Fehlerkorrekturen enthält (und selten neue Fehler einführt). SOX wird auf einer Vielzahl von Plattformen, Browsern und Konfigurationen verwendet. So können Sie auf einfache Weise ein potenzielles Problem vermeiden, das von einem anderen Benutzer entdeckt und bereits behoben wurde.



21

Ich habe letztes Jahr eine Chrome-Erweiterung geschrieben, um die Hot Network Questions-Liste auszublenden / zu filtern . Sie können damit nicht nur die Links nach einer Website oder einer Keyword-Whitelist oder Blacklist filtern, sondern auch, da ich festgestellt habe, dass bestimmte Websites normalerweise ablenken, andere jedoch häufig hilfreich sind.

Sie können es aus dem Chrome Web Store installieren oder den Code auf GitHub auschecken . ( Ursprünglich auf MSE geteilt ).


19

Mit uBlock Origin unter Windows 7 mit FireFox 50.1.0 konnte ich das gewünschte Ergebnis erzielen:

Bildbeschreibung hier eingeben

FWIW: Ich bevorzuge uBlock Origin 10-fach gegenüber ABP.

ABP ist ausverkauft, aber Sie können ihre akzeptablen Anzeigen deaktivieren .

uBlock fühlt sich schneller an und es ist einfacher, eine Site vorübergehend zu entsperren und erneut zu blockieren.


9
Betreff: "ABP ist ausverkauft": Es kann in den Einstellungen deaktiviert werden.
Amani Kilumanga,

2
@AmaniKilumanga Die Tatsache, dass dies die Standardeinstellung ist, bedeutet, dass ihre Ziele nicht mehr mit den meisten Zielen ihrer Benutzer
übereinstimmen

2
@Menasheh Ich stimme zu, dass es eine schlechte Wahl ist, und ich bin sicher, dass viele Benutzer einfach nicht wissen, dass es passiert, aber ich denke, dass es erwähnenswert ist (etwas, das dem verlinkten Artikel völlig zu fehlen scheint).
Amani Kilumanga

1
@AmaniKilumanga Ich werde gerne meine Antwort ändern. Bitte geben Sie die offizielle ABP-URL an, unter der Sie erfahren, wie Sie die neue Funktion deaktivieren können.
MonkeyZeus


14

Ich verwende Chrome unter Windows und es hat wie ein Zauber funktioniert.

Vielleicht versuchen Sie es mit denselben Elementen wie meinen.

Element entfernen

Element entfernt


10

Hier ist ein anderer Ansatz. Anstatt das Erscheinen von Hot Network Questions zu blockieren, blockiere ich die Möglichkeit, zu den Zielen der Links zu gelangen.

Ich habe festgestellt, dass ich viel Zeit verschwendet habe, um die interessanten Hot Network-Fragen zu beantworten. Deshalb habe ich LeechbBock installiert und so eingestellt, dass nur * .stackexchange.com für so viele Minuten pro Stunde zulässig ist. Auf diese Weise kann ich die interessanten lesen, aber nicht zu lange damit verbringen.

Leechblock ist sehr praktisch, um Sie sanft anzustoßen, damit Sie nicht zu viel Zeit auf Websites verbringen, die Sie blockieren möchten.

(Ironischerweise habe ich diese Frage beantwortet, weil ich sie bei Hot Network Questions gesehen habe.)


1
Wenn Sie * .stackexchange.com blockieren, können Sie, obwohl Sie den HNQ sehen können, keinen von ihnen erreichen, da sie sich (meistens) auf * .stackexchange.com befinden.
Matthew Lock

7

Sie können das Stylus-Browser-Addon (oder ähnliches) verwenden und allen SE-Sites das folgende CSS hinzufügen:

#hot-network-questions {
  display: none;
}

Beispiel aus einer Vollversion für Stylus hier :

@namespace url(http://www.w3.org/1999/xhtml);

/* From https://gist.github.com/akerbos/152d7891d2b8b34edf3a */

@-moz-document domain('stackoverflow.com'),
domain('stackexchange.com'),
domain('superuser.com'),
domain('serverfault.com'),
domain('stackapps.com'),
domain('askubuntu.com'),
domain('mathoverflow.com'),
domain('answers.onstartups.com'),
domain('mathoverflow.net') {
  #hot-network-questions {
    display : none;
  }
}

Verwenden Sie "Mozilla Format> Import".


2

Wie in der Meta Stack Exchange- Veröffentlichung "Aktualisieren der Hot Network-Fragenliste" beschrieben - jetzt mit etwas mehr Netzwerk und etwas weniger "Hotness"! - Sie können die HNQ-Liste global in der Seitenleiste ausblenden, indem Sie Ihre Einstellungsseite aufrufen und im Abschnitt "Seitenleiste" die Option "Hot-Network-Fragen ausblenden" auswählen.

Benutzerpräferenz, um HNQ-Seitenleistenabschnitt global zu entfernen

Die Registerkarte mit den Benutzerprofileinstellungen ist heute etwas überfüllt. Sie haben jetzt die Möglichkeit, das Widget "HNQ-Liste" in der rechten Seitenleiste zu deaktivieren. Wenn Sie die HNQ-Liste nicht sehen möchten, müssen Sie nicht! Also, wenn Sie schon seit Jahren davon geträumt haben, gehen Sie in die Seitenleiste Ihrer Einstellungen und ändern Sie sie! Die HNQ-Liste ist standardmäßig für alle Benutzer sichtbar.

Einstellungen für Hot Network-Fragen auf der Seite mit den Benutzereinstellungen ausblenden

Es gibt einige Gründe, warum wir mit dieser Lösung beginnen:

  • Es funktioniert auf jeder Site und jedem Gerät, das Sie verwenden.
  • Dies können wir relativ schnell umsetzen und ein verlässliches Ergebnis erzielen.

Es gibt ein paar Dinge, die es nicht tut:

  1. Lässt Sie die HNQ-Liste nicht auf verschiedenen Sites oder Geräten anzeigen oder ausblenden.
  2. Ist keine Option für nicht angemeldete Benutzer.
  3. Lässt Sie nicht anpassen, welche Websites Sie entweder über eine Whitelist oder eine Blacklist sehen.

Während ich 1 und 2 lösen möchte, indem ich es möglich mache, den Abschnitt in der Seitenleiste der Seite auszublenden und diesen Zustand als Cookie zu speichern, wird das etwas mehr Designarbeit erfordern, sodass wir es vorerst auf Eis legen . Das Lösen von # 3 ist wahrscheinlich sehr kompliziert zu implementieren, daher haben wir vorerst keine Pläne dafür.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.